Job Summary

The Office of Sponsored Projects Administration (OSPA) is seeking a Research Training Specialist Principle.

This position is eligible for remote work.

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to …

  • Serve as a Subject-Matter Expert (SME) for training courses.
  • Independently deliver training courses, e-learning, video tutorials, and learning simulations
  • Edit training courses and materials to ensure accuracy of content
  • Serve as OSPA’s point of contact and subject-matter expert for the development and implementation of electronic research administration systems
  • Develop training curriculum that identifies and addresses the following: diverse range of federal, state, foundation and UK policy knowledge, technical systems knowledge, critical thinking and other soft skills
  • Develop training curriculum that creates a holistic knowledge base of sponsored projects from a cradle to grave sponsored project life cycle and how it relates to UK processes and policies

The Department

OSPA is responsible for administering over $480 million in extramural grants and contracts awarded through the University of Kentucky Research Foundation. Services are available to all University faculty and staff and include: advice and assistance with budget preparation and other administrative requirements of proposals; proposal submission; review, negotiation and acceptance of awards; interpretation and information regarding sponsor policies and regulations; preparation of subcontract documents; administration of UK’s Conflict of Interest Policy.
